DHAKA BANK PLC. AND MASHREQBANK PSC, UAE, SIGN MASTER TRADE LOAN AGREEMENT TO STRENGTHEN TRADE FINANCE COLLABORATION

Dhaka Bank PLC. has signed a Master Trade Loan Agreement (MTLA) with Mashreqbank PSC, UAE, marking another milestone in the longstanding partnership between the two financial institutions that dates back to 1995.

The signing ceremony took place at Dhaka Bank’s Head Office on the 28th of July, 2026, where Mr. Osman Ershad Faiz, Managing Director of Dhaka Bank PLC., and Ms. Sharifa Mohamed, Regional Head of FI – Asia, Mashreqbank PSC, UAE, signed the agreement on behalf of their respective organizations.

The agreement will further enhance cooperation between the two institutions in facilitating trade and strengthening Dhaka Bank’s access to international financial support for cross border transactions.

Speaking on the occasion, Mr. Osman Ershad Faiz expressed his appreciation for the continued partnership with Mashreqbank and highlighted the importance of such collaborations in expanding trade finance capabilities and delivering value to customers.

The signing ceremony was attended by senior officials from both organizations, including Mr. Akhlaqur Rahman, Deputy Managing Director and Mr. Abu Jahid Ansary, Head of International Division of Dhaka Bank PLC., Mr. Suvadeep Sinha, Senior Vice President, Corporate Credit, Mashreqbank, UAE, Ms. Fahmida Sharmeen, Chief Country Representative, Mashreqbank Bangladesh, along with other officials.

The agreement represents a significant step in advancing institutional partnership between Dhaka Bank PLC. and Mashreqbank PSC, UAE, while reflecting the confidence and mutual trust built over three decades of relationship.
